The mountain guide, an ------- and fearless climber, had successfully scaled several of the world's most challenging peaks.
intrepid
cautious
anxious
inexperienced
Explanation
The phrase "and fearless climber" provides a direct clue, as does the accomplishment of scaling challenging peaks. "Intrepid" is a synonym for fearless and adventurous. 'Anxious,' 'inexperienced,' and 'cautious' are all contradicted by the context clues.

Although the twins were physically identical, their personalities were quite -------, one being outgoing and the other reserved.
divergent
sociable
identical
compatible
Explanation
The word "Although" signals a contrast between the twins' physical appearance and their personalities. The description of one being "outgoing" and the other "reserved" confirms their personalities are different. "Divergent" means tending to be different or develop in different directions, which accurately describes this contrast. 'Compatible' means able to exist together without conflict, which might be true but doesn't describe the difference. 'Identical' is the opposite of what the context implies. 'Sociable' describes only the outgoing twin, not the difference between them.
The initial report on the new species was merely -------; a more thorough and definitive study was needed to confirm the findings.
comprehensive
absolute
erroneous
tentative
Explanation
The semicolon and the phrase "a more thorough and definitive study was needed" indicate a contrast with the initial report. This suggests the first report was provisional or uncertain. "Tentative" means not certain or fixed, which fits the context. 'Absolute' and 'comprehensive' are antonyms of the correct answer. 'Erroneous' means wrong, but the sentence implies the report was just incomplete or unconfirmed, not necessarily incorrect.
The politician’s speech was so -------, filled with unnecessary repetitions and irrelevant points, that the audience soon lost interest.
eloquent
concise
persuasive
redundant
Explanation
The phrase "filled with unnecessary repetitions and irrelevant points" acts as a definition for the missing word. "Redundant" means containing superfluous or repetitive material, which fits the description perfectly. 'Concise' is the opposite, meaning brief and comprehensive. 'Persuasive' and 'eloquent' are positive descriptions of a speech, which is contradicted by the fact that the audience lost interest.

The constant noise from the construction site began to ------- the patience of the nearby residents.
create
bolster
pacify
erode
Explanation
The context implies that "constant noise" would have a negative, wearing effect on patience. "Erode" means to gradually wear away or destroy, which metaphorically fits what would happen to patience. 'Bolster' means to support or strengthen, and 'pacify' means to calm, both of which are opposites of the intended meaning. 'Create' doesn't make sense in this context.
Her ------- in negotiating the complex deal earned her the respect of her colleagues and a promotion.
ineptitude
apathy
hesitation
acumen
Explanation
The positive outcomes ("earned her the respect...and a promotion") indicate that the missing word must describe a valuable skill or quality. "Acumen" means the ability to make good judgments and quick decisions, which is a key skill in negotiations. 'Hesitation,' 'ineptitude' (lack of skill), and 'apathy' (lack of interest) are all negative qualities that would not lead to respect and a promotion.
Years of neglect had left the historic mansion in a state of -------, with peeling paint, broken windows, and an overgrown garden.
opulence
restoration
disrepair
prominence
Explanation
The cause is "years of neglect," and the listed effects ("peeling paint, broken windows," etc.) describe a state of decay. "Disrepair" means a poor condition resulting from neglect, which accurately summarizes the situation. 'Opulence' means great wealth, and 'restoration' is the process of fixing, both of which are the opposite of the context. 'Prominence' means being important or famous, which doesn't describe the physical state of the house.
